Healthy Home Fundamentals
As real estate professionals, we need to be conscientious to assure that the investments we are representing to our clients are not only a good value and meets their needs, but also that it is a healthy place for them to live and raise their children. In an effort to achieve healthier housing, this course will take a look at the concerns and solutions regarding lead, mold, carbon monoxide, and allergens. This course will delve deeply into each subject and suggest ways that we as professionals can look to eliminate these concerns.
